About Cong He

Cong He is a scholar working on Infectious Diseases, Critical Care and Intensive Care Medicine, Neurology, Otorhinolaryngology and Mechanics of Materials, having authored 15 papers that have together received 354 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Long-Term Effects of COVID-19 (2 papers), COVID-19 Clinical Research Studies (2 papers), Folate and B Vitamins Research (1 paper), Sinusitis and nasal conditions (1 paper), SARS-CoV-2 detection and testing (1 paper), Liver Disease and Transplantation (1 paper), Hepatitis B Virus Studies (1 paper) and Metabolism and Genetic Disorders (1 paper). The work is most often cited by research in Infectious Diseases (169 citations), Gastroenterology (27 citations), Neurology (74 citations), Critical Care and Intensive Care Medicine (17 citations) and Otorhinolaryngology (14 citations). Cong He has collaborated with scholars based in China. Frequent co-authors include Yihan Yu, Bo Xu, Anlu Wang, Wenguang Xia, Qing Miao, Jixian Zhang, Tingting Xu, Xiaosu Wang, Jianning Zhang and Yi Wang. Their work appears in journals such as World Journal of Gastroenterology, PLoS ONE, European Archives of Oto-Rhino-Laryngology, Journal of Multidisciplinary Healthcare and Journal of X-Ray Science and Technology.
